The bus was proceeding westwards loaded with people returning home from business when the platform was raided by a party of French visitors.
" Flup," shouted the conductor from the top, waiting-to give three rings. " Flup," he reiterated, but still the invaders pressed forward.
Then he decided to call upon his war-time French. " Onne pars par," he shouted, and it had the desired effect,
